Wendell is a town in Wake County, North Carolina United States. It is a satellite town of Raleigh, the state capital. The population was 5,845 at the 2010 census.[4]
Incorporated in 1903, Wendell was settled in the 1850s, when farmers in Granville County were victims of a blight that came to be known as the Granville County Wilt. Their tobacco crops failed, and they chose to move to a new location with more fertile land for their crops.

The image eyes mentioned above ought to not be set up greater than six inches above the garage floor. If the eyes are installed higher, a person or animal could get under the beam and not be detected by the picture eyes.
The wall push button for your garage door opener should be installed at least 5 feet above the flooring, out of the reach of children. Running under a closing door can be a fatal game. Teach your children never to have fun with opening and closing the door. Do You Know Where Your Remote Controls Are? For the reasons just discussed, keep the push-button controls for your openers where children can not have fun with them.
For security factors, make sure to keep your push-button controls locked up. If you park an automobile outside your garage, make sure to lock your vehicle so that prospective intruders can not access your remote control and gain simple access to your garage. Rolling Codes. Some thieves have the ability to “tape-record” your transmitter’s signal.
Nevertheless, if your transmitter (the remote control) has rolling code technology, the code changes after every use. This renders the thieves’ controls ineffective. Turnaround TestMake sure your opener has a reversing feature. If a reversing feature is not present, the opener needs to be changed. Garage door openers produced after January 1, 1993, are needed by federal law to have actually advanced security functions that adhere to the most current UL (Underwriters Laboratories) 325 requirements. Contact your manufacturer or installer for extra info.
Evaluate the reversing feature on a monthly basis. Initially, test the balance of the door. If the door is properly balanced, then proceed. 2. With the door totally open, put a 1-1/2″ thick piece of wood (a 2″ X 4″ laid flat) on the floor in the center of the door. 3.
The door should reverse when it strikes the blockage. (Note that the bottom part of “one-piece doors” must be stiff so that the door will not close, but will reverse when it contacts the obstruction.) 4. If the door does not reverse, have it fixed or replaced. Have a certified professional adjust, repair, or change the opener or door.
If the door does not reverse readily, the force setting might be extreme and need adjusting. See your owner’s handbook for details on how to make the adjustment. Extra Security DevicesMany garage door openers can be equipped with extra security devices, such as photo eyes or edge sensors, to secure against entrapment.

Make certain the extra security devices are effectively set up and adjusted (see owner’s handbook). TESTING AND MAINTAINING THE GARAGE DOORPerform regular upkeep actions as soon as a month. Review your owner’s manual for the garage door. If you do not have a handbook, try to find the design number on the back of the door, or inspect the lock handle, hinges, or other hardware for the producer’s name and request a handbook from the producer.
If you presume issues, have a qualified individual make repairs. Garage door springs, cables, brackets, and other hardware connected to the springs are under extremely high tension and, if managed improperly, can cause severe injury. Only a qualified expert or a mechanically skilled individual needs to adjust them, however only by carefully following the manufacturer’s instructions.
Do not try to repair or adjust torsion springs yourself. A limiting cable television or other device must be set up on the extension spring (the spring along the side of the door) to assist contain the spring if it breaks. Never ever remove, adjust, or loosen the screws on the bottom brackets of the door.
Regularly lubricate the moving parts of the door. Nevertheless, do not lube plastic idler bearings. Consult the door owner’s handbook for the manufacturer’s recommendation. Door BalancePeriodically check the balance of your door. Start with the door closed. If you have a garage door opener, use the release system so you can operate the door by hand when doing this test.
It must remain open around 3 or 4 feet above the floor. If it does not, it runs out adjustment. Have it changed by a competent service person.
